Best Upscale Cuisine

Cafe Poca Cosa

Café Poca Cosa's main chef, Suzana Davila, has been spotlighted in The New York Times, Gourmet Magazine, Great Chefs Magazine, and the list goes on. But no one needs these publications to tell us what we already have known for years: When it comes to fine Mexican dining, you go to Poca Cosa, bar none. Sure, it's a bit pricey, but you certainly get what you pay for. The menu is all over the map, with all sorts of authentic Northern Mexican recipes that are all worth a try. The full bar has margaritas that are so good we'd really like to know where you can get a better one, and that leaves Cafe Poca Cosa as one of Tucson's most magical places.
